What is Heroin Use Disorder?
Heroin use disorder happens when someone regularly misuses heroin, leading to both physical dependence and strong psychological cravings. It often causes serious health problems, strains relationships, and makes it hard to stop using the drug, even when it’s clearly causing harm.
Heroin addiction, a form of substance use disorder, impacts the brain’s reward system, making recovery without support challenging. With proper heroin addiction treatment options, including detox programs and evidence-based therapies, people can overcome this condition. Rehabilitation treatment for heroin use disorder often involves a combination of medical care, behavioral therapy, and aftercare to achieve lasting recovery.
What is Heroin Addiction Rehab?
Heroin addiction rehab is a structured program designed to help people overcome heroin dependence through medical care, therapy, and support. Such programs typically include detox, counseling, and strategies to manage triggers and cravings, empowering people to build a healthier, drug-free life.
Heroin rehab programs often focus on evidence-based addiction treatment, combining medical detox with behavioral therapies and holistic care. Heroin abuse recovery programs may include inpatient rehab, outpatient support, and aftercare planning to promote long-term recovery. By addressing the physical, emotional, and social aspects of addiction, these recovery programs provide a wide-ranging path to overcoming substance misuse.

Types of Insurance Plans That May Cover Heroin Addiction Treatment
Various health insurance plans may offer coverage for heroin addiction treatment, but the level of insurance coverage depends on the type of plan and its type of benefits. Understanding your insurance plan can help you decide on the care you need for recovery. Here are some common types of insurance plans that may provide coverage:
- Private Health Insurance: Many private insurance plans deliver thorough heroin addiction treatment coverage, often including detox, rehab, and aftercare services.
- PPO Plans: Preferred Provider Organization (PPO) plans provide flexibility to access both in-network and out-of-network providers for heroin addiction care.
- HMO Plans: Health Maintenance Organization (HMO) plans typically cover addiction treatment services but require the use of in-network providers for coverage.
- POS Plans: Point of Service (POS) plans combine HMO and PPO features, offering in-network coverage and partial benefits for out-of-network care.
- Employer Group Plans: Employer-sponsored insurance plans typically include substance abuse treatment benefits, helping employees access drug addiction rehab and recovery services.

How Much Does Heroin Rehab Cost in Tennessee Without Health Insurance?
The cost of heroin rehab in Tennessee without health insurance typically ranges from $25,000 to $78,000 per month. This breaks down to approximately $830 to $2,600 per day for inpatient residential addiction treatment services, highlighting the financial importance of considering insurance or alternative payment options.

Medically Supervised Heroin Detox
Medically supervised heroin detox is an important first step in recovery, providing people with professional care while managing withdrawal symptoms in a safe manner. This process includes continuous medical monitoring, symptom relief, and psychological support to deal with the physical challenges of heroin dependency.
Insurance plans frequently cover detox services as part of an extensive treatment approach. Access to this care allows patients to engage in detoxification under the supervision of medical professionals, reducing health risks and facilitating a smooth transition into further treatment.

Outpatient and IOP for Heroin Addiction Recovery
Outpatient programs and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OPs) allow people to continue recovery while living at home. Options like these offer flexibility with structured therapy sessions, skill-building activities, and group support to help patients maintain sobriety and balance their daily responsibilities.
Most insurance providers cover outpatient and IOP services, allowing people to have more affordable treatment options. This shows that recovery is not only effective but also accessible, regardless of financial or scheduling constraints.
Heroin Addiction Counseling and Therapies
Counseling and evidence-based therapies,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and group therapy, play a vital role in heroin addiction recovery. CBT and group therapy can help people address underlying emotional and psychological factors associated with addiction while building strategies for relapse prevention.
Health insurance typically includes coverage for personal counseling and therapy sessions. This access to professional guidance is a key component of recovery, providing patients with the tools needed for self-awareness and long-term change.
